Output 59faabec00ec8e8ffb59fb15939f81fc7da10b348eeff68cc87eb482dd0ff7bf:168

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 8fe330baec38c5f432640077b9c06aaf34be3e4a
address
bc1q3l3npwhv8rzlgvnyqpmmnsr24u6tu0j2eu74s5
transaction
59faabec00ec8e8ffb59fb15939f81fc7da10b348eeff68cc87eb482dd0ff7bf